Title: Ferrari’s Nightmare at Dutch GP: Leclerc Sounds Alarm Over Shocking Performance Shortfall

In a stunning revelation that has sent shockwaves through the motorsport community, Charles Leclerc has declared that Ferrari faced its “worst Friday of the season” at the Formula 1 Dutch Grand Prix. This alarming admission follows a catastrophic performance, with the Scuderia finishing both practice sessions well outside the top 10, landing in a dismal 14th and 15th place during the opening rounds at Zandvoort.

Emerging from the summer break, Ferrari had high hopes of closing the gap to the dominant McLaren team, especially after narrowly missing out on victory in Hungary. However, the reality was far from their aspirations, as Leclerc lamented the precious opportunity that slipped through their fingers, emphasizing the stakes for both himself and the team in their quest for a long-awaited win this season.

“Today was a wake-up call,” Leclerc stated, encapsulating the frustration that permeated the Ferrari garage. The Monegasque driver did not mince words, labeling Friday’s ordeal as “probably the worst Friday of the season.” Despite his optimism for future opportunities in 2025, the disheartening evidence from practice sessions painted a grim picture for the Scuderia, as McLaren showcased their unparalleled pace yet again while Ferrari seemed to be stuck in a performance rut.

Leclerc’s disappointment was palpable as he reflected on the struggles faced in both FP1 and FP2. “FP1 was extremely difficult. FP2 was slightly better, but still very far off where we want to be,” he expressed with a heavy heart. The stark contrast between Ferrari’s capabilities and those of their rivals was unmistakable, with Leclerc admitting, “I don’t expect to fully return the situation because McLaren is in a league of its own.”

A deeper investigation into Ferrari’s woes revealed a startling detail: the team’s performance deficit is shockingly concentrated in just two corners of the Zandvoort circuit. “We are losing basically 90% of the time in two corners,” Leclerc explained, leaving the team scrambling for answers as they headed into the crucial hours before Saturday’s qualifying. “Normally, that’s never the case,” he added, underscoring the urgency of the situation.

As they look ahead, Leclerc’s expectations for a turnaround remain tempered but hopeful. “It’s a very strange season – I would have never said that I will be on pole in Budapest,” he remarked, reflecting on the unpredictable nature of the sport. “I don’t want to really fix myself targets today because after what was a very difficult weekend, it’s not very exciting targets.”

Teammate Lewis Hamilton echoed Leclerc’s sentiments, acknowledging the challenges but also highlighting a sense of cautious optimism. “It’s not been the worst of days. I think we were making progress, but we’ve got some work to do overnight,” he stated, hinting at a glimmer of hope amidst the struggle.
